Some minor suggestions: #1 - add a little more space on the left, the direction in which the lizard is facing; #2 - did you catch its whole tail in the original?; #3 - doesn't quite work because the branch obscures the birds; #4 - nice pic, try using spot focus next time for an even sharper spider. Good sharp focus on the others, and good color on all.

The spider and first lizard are wonderful. The EXIF for both of these images report Aperture Priority. You might consider stepping down slightly for more depth of field and / or lens sharpness. Look too at your DPP sharpness setting. If processing from RAW, try values 4 to 5, depending on the composition.
